T Razr

In the near future, the booming of electric transportation development is at the door. As a car part manufacturer, Maxxis keeps thinking how it can design a feasible smart system that can participate in this trend and even help accelerate it. T Razr is a smart tire developed for the need. Its built-in sensors actively detect different driving conditions and provide active signals to transform the tire. The magnified treads stretch and change the contact area in response to the signal, therefore improve the traction performance.

Electric

This is probably one of the worlds lightest electric bicycles with a weight of only 9,5 kilos. The design team has developed a frame is made out of a kevlar and carbon combination making it both strong and extremely light at the same time. A unique center motor is used to create the right amount of force and torque for the rider when he or she uses the bike. The battery is a patented construction hidden in the frame. The bike is equipped with high end components seen in professional cycling. This is the ultimate electric bike for the rider who needs a little assistance from the motor system.

Cicare 8

The Cicare 8 is a two seater ultralight helicopter that integrates aeronautical heritage with industrial precision. The design features a carbon fiber semi-monocoque cabin with an organic morphology inspired by feline features to communicate agility. Its structural configuration combines a composite cockpit with a steel space frame. Key functional elements include panoramic glazing for enhanced visibility and a patented adjustable control system. The aircraft fulfills international certification standards, focusing on professional grade finishes and aerodynamic.

Aistaland GT7

Aistaland GT7, an intelligent shooting brake coupe, integrates rational industrial design with L3 autonomous driving technology. Continuous Intelligent Driving Blue Light communicates the vehicle's operational status from all directions, enhancing transparency and helping build driver confidence in real world traffic environments. Key technologies include active safety hood, integrated 88 inch Ar-Hud display, Huawei Dlp 3.0 projection technology and dynamic tweeter diffuser co developed with Huawei. Together, these systems create a clear, safe and engaging human machine interaction experience.
